Ritchie Bros. Sells 2,700+ items for $41MM+ in Grande Prairie, AB

December 06, 2021, 07:05 AM
Filed Under: Auction News

Ritchie Bros. held a three-day unreserved auction in Grande Prairie, AB, selling more than 2,700 equipment items and trucks for over 400 consignors, generating over $41 million in gross transaction value.

The online auction attracted 10,000+ bidders from 47 countries. Approximately 96 percent of the equipment was sold to Canadian buyers, including 49 percent sold to Albertans, while the remaining 4 percent was purchased by international buyers from as far away as India, Vietnam and Ukraine.

"We had a great selection of late-model, low-hour assets in Grande Prairie, with something for everyone, including yellow iron, trucks, a nice aggregate package, forestry equipment, and even real estate," said Terry Moon, Regional Sales Manager, Ritchie Bros. "We continued to see very aggressive bidding and robust pricing across almost every single asset category in this auction.”
